SUMMARY:SMART Series 2020 - Cash Flow and Profitability
DESCRIPTION:Cashflow and Profitability\n\n\n\nThis will be held as a webinar...\n\n \nWould you like to manage your cash flow better\, understand business financials\, and improve profitability?\n\nLet's face it. The most common reason for business failure is lack of cash flow. So\, if you're worrying about cash flow\, or confusion around financials has you tossing and turning at night\, then this workshop is sure to give you some helpful insight. \n\n \n\nYou don't have to be great with numbers to attend. Just bring a calculator and your business financials to review on the day. (If you don't have financials to bring along\, that's OK too.)\n\n \n\nWhat will you get:\n\n\n Understanding key financial documents (P&L\, balance sheet and cash flow statements)\n How to calculate your business break even point\n Understanding the cash gap that can bring businesses down\n What is margin vs markup\n Why a ratio analysis is important\n Benchmarking to help you judge how you're doing relative to your competition\n Budgeting and strategies to improve cash flow and profits\n\n\n \n\nThis workshop is suitable for:\n\nBusiness owners or employees wanting to improve their financial knowledge\, cash flow or profitability.\n\n \n\nAbout the presenters:\n\nBruce Manefield FAICD is a business coach and trainer for Rapport Leadership International.
